What Families Think

Reviews of Medilodge Of Shoreline are mixed: several families and residents praise the rehabilitation and activity staff as friendly and attentive, while others describe serious safety incidents and unresponsive communication from administration and corporate leadership. The facility appears to have improved its activities and dining variety over the past two years, according to at least one longtime resident.

The Good

  • Rehab staff called friendly, professional, and compassionate
  • Daily activities with prizes, including bingo five days a week
  • Dining room offers more variety for meals now
  • Respite (short-term) stays available and praised by a family
  • Director of Nursing resolved resident concerns promptly

The Bad

  • One report of abuse allegation handled poorly by staff
  • One resident says they were attacked in the dining room without intervention
  • Multiple accounts of unanswered voicemails and unresponsive corporate contacts
  • One report of physical therapy evaluation not submitted, delaying equipment

About Medilodge Of Shoreline

Medilodge Of Shoreline is a skilled nursing / long term care community in Sterling Heights, Michigan. The community is licensed for up to 112 residents.

Families rate Medilodge Of Shoreline 3.7 out of 5 based on 77 Google reviews.
